I walked into the haven on April 29 2014 strung out, hopeless, and scared. This was the first time i have ever gotten sober before and it was terrifying. I did not know how to live sober, i was used to living in chaos and that was how my life was pure chaos. Going to the haven was the scariest most beneficial thing to ever happen to me. It was the first place that i was actually able to look at the underlining reasons why i decided to use drugs and alcohol in the first place. The way they run the program is amazing it is difficult at times but it will change your life if you let it. The haven did not only give me my life back, but it also gave me a family. If you would of told me i would be where i am at today 2 years ago i would tell you that you were full of it. The haven and the staff there actually care about the individuals who attend there. It is a place i hold sacred to my heart because of all of the good they have done not only for me but for all of my friends. It is a wonderful program and i highly recommend it to anyone trying to get help. Sense i have graduated the haven i have not only got sober and learned how to live life sober, but i have started college and have a wonderful job. This place introduced me to alcoholics anonymous which i never thought i would ever go to. But in the end it has saved my life more than once and i will for ever be grateful for the haven
One year ago today I decided it was time for me to stop taking pills and drinking everyday. I enrolled in Turning Points 30 day out patient program. It was a very humbling experience. When I first started I new I had a pill problem but I was in denial about my alcoholism. After a few group therapy sessions and some one on one I realized I was an alcoholic and I was able to start working on that problem. Turning point gave me the tools to apply in my everyday life. Without the help of there therapist I seriously doubt that I would have stayed sober very long. It\'s amazing how much easier my life is with drugs or alcohol! To anyone out there that is considering rehab, I would highly recommend Turning Point.
